TONIGHT’S SCRIPTURE:
Isaiah 55:8–9
[8] For my thoughts are not your thoughts, neither are your ways my ways, declares the LORD. [9] For as the heavens are higher than the earth, so are my ways higher than your ways and my thoughts than your thoughts. (ESV)
SUMMARY
We reflect on Isaiah’s claim that God’s thoughts and ways are higher than ours and invite listeners to rest in that truth as the day ends. Through prayer and reflection, we trade the urge to control for the steadiness of trust in God’s care.

Setting The Evening Mindset
CareyThe Lord God says, My thoughts are not your thoughts, neither are your ways my ways, declares the Lord. For as the heavens are higher than the earth, so are my ways higher than your ways, and my thoughts than your thoughts. That's our evening mindset. Ponder it as the music plays. You see, we live in a world that says human beings are the most important thing on the planet. We are the be-all, end-all of everything. And that simply isn't true. Isaiah 55, verses 8 through 9, God points out how untrue that is. For our good, actually. He wants us to recognize that the things he's doing in our lives, though many times perplexing and even unsettling and difficult, are things that have not happened by accident or outside his awareness. He says his thoughts are not our thoughts, and his ways are not our ways. He does things in God-sized ways, according to God-sized reasons. And he gives us an illustration. He says, for as the heavens are higher than the earth, he's talking about outer space, the stars, the planets, the galaxies. As the heavens are higher than the earth, so are my ways higher than your ways, and my thoughts than your thoughts. So in other words, he's giving us the understanding that his perspective is one of oversight. He's looking over it all. He sees everything. Which is why the things that are happening that may not make sense to us are still, nevertheless, firmly in his control and in his grasp. Oh, friends, as you go to bed tonight, rest in that reality. No matter what you're going through, God, your God, knows what he's doing. And he is for you. You care for us. And you're caring for us in the midst of our difficulties that we don't understand, that bring stress into our lives, and maybe even are making us sick. Lord, we want to rest in you. Teach us how tonight to go to bed with assurance and comfort from the fact that your ways and your thoughts are higher than ours. We rest in you today.
